Hello, 
I am currently using NXP's official evaluation board to debug solenoid valves. The Loaddata file in the software is generated by Mc33PT2000 Developer Studio, ensuring that the current block corresponds to the bank. The microCode codes of the two banks are also the same and the solenoid valves are the same. They have also been exchanged. However, the inj3 signal output by bank2 and the inj5 signal output by bank3 are different. In the data-RAM array, the current and voltage configurations of both are the same. Bank2 and 3 are not broken and can work normally. The only difference is that the two have the same configuration (voltage, current, time, microCode code, load solenoid valve, etc.) but different outputs. This makes it difficult for me to understand

Hello YM S,

please enable the bias for all channels.

JozefKozon_0-1724919749625.png

And please try to change the monitoring thresholds.
